ZIP code 23056 is a sparsely populated 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Foster, Mathews County, Virginia, home to just 458 residents across 15.4 square miles, a density of 30 people per square mile, in the New York time zone.
ZIP 23056 lands in the middle-income range, with a median household income of $79,205 (7% below the average Virginia ZIP), while per-capita income is $33,727. The poverty rate is 8.6%, with unemployment at 0.0%; those measures add context to the income figure. Median home value is $340,500 (2% above the average Virginia ZIP); 100.0% of occupied homes are owner-occupied.
